练习 - 创建和运行 AL 扩展

已完成

您是 Cronus International Ltd. 的开发人员,正在学习如何在 Visual Studio Code 开发环境中创建对象。 首先,创建新 AL 扩展,然后将该扩展发布到您的测试环境。 完成任务后,您会看到一条 Hello World 消息。

完成以下任务

  • 安装 AL 语言扩展。

  • 创建新 AL 扩展项目。

  • 将 AL 扩展部署到云沙盒。

步骤

  1. 启动 Visual Studio Code。

  2. 选择视图,然后选择扩展 (Ctrl+Shift+X)。

  3. 在市场中搜索扩展搜索框中输入 AL 语言

  4. 选择绿色的安装按钮。

  5. 创建新 AL 扩展项目。 选择视图命令面板... (Ctrl+Shift+P)。

  6. 在搜索框中输入 AL: Go!,然后从列表中选择命令。

  7. 接受建议的路径(或输入其他路径)。

  8. 选择与您的沙盒版本匹配的目标平台。

  9. 选择 Microsoft 云沙盒作为开发终结点。

  10. 下载应用程序符号。 选择视图命令面板... (Ctrl+Shift+P)。

  11. 在搜索框中输入 AL: 下载符号,然后从列表中选择命令。

  12. 如果需要,请提供您的组织凭据(Microsoft 365 帐户/Microsoft Entra ID 帐户)。

  13. 验证您是否看到一个名为 .alpackages 的文件夹,其中包含三个 .app 文件。

  14. 确认 HelloWorld.al 文件未显示为红色。

  15. 打开 HelloWorld.al 文件并验证客户列表是否不带红色下划线。

  16. 打开 app.json 文件,将“name”设置更改为 Hello World。 将“publisher”设置更改为 Cronus International Ltd

  17. 打开 .vscode 文件夹中的 launch.json 文件,验证 startupObjectId 设置是否设为 22,以及 startupObjectType 是否设为页面

  18. 将扩展发布到沙盒。 选择视图命令面板... (Ctrl+Shift+P)。

  19. 在搜索框中输入 AL: Publish (F5),然后从列表中选择命令。

  20. 验证 Dynamics 365 Business Central 应用程序是否启动以及 Hello World 消息框是否显示。